摘要
In this work we have studied the effects of MgO addition on magnetic properties and corrosion resistance of NdFeB magnets. We have found that remanence and density of the magnet can be increased by intergranular addition of MgO. For Nd15Dy1.2FebalAl0.8B6 magnets with 0.1-0.3 wt.% MgO addition, corrosion potential of magnets is more positive, and polarization current density under the same applied potential in the anodic branch of the polarization curve is lowered compared with magnet without additives. This indicates that intergranular addition of MgO can improve the corrosion resistance of magnets. Furthermore, oxidation test also indicates the magnets with MgO addition are more resistant to humid environment. Enhance of corrosion resistance of magnets is believed to be due to the formation of a Nd-O-Fe-Mg intergranular phase. (C) 2007 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
